DescriptionPrenatal Vinyasa Yoga with Jennifer Wolfe offers a complete, safe, and active workout for all 3 trimesters and prepares you, your body and your baby for childbirth and postpartum recovery. ***************This 2 DVD set provides you the most flexibility to tailor your yoga practice to meet your busy schedule and your energy level. It Features:***************** 15, 30, 45 & 75 Minute PracticesChoose the length of your practice each day based on how much time you have and how your body is feeling. Each practice is different, so you won’t get bored** 5 & 15 Minute RelaxationsPrepare your mind and body for labor by training your body to relax using this 5 minute relaxation, a great way to end your yoga practice**Safe Modifications for all 3 TrimestersAll 3 trimesters are modeled so you can modify your practice as your baby grows and your body changes**10 Minute Partner Routin. . . I just received this DVD in the mail yesterday and could not be happier with it!!! I did the 45 min workout and found it very challenging (by the end my legs were shaking). I have been practicing Vinyasa Yoga and pilates for about a year at a local studio, and am getting to the point in my pregnancy where going to the regular classes is starting to feel a bit useless since I can no longer do many of the poses. I was concerned that a pre natal routine would be too easy, but that is definitely not the case here. This is a must for all mommies to be who want enjoy the benefits of staying fit during pregnancy.

One thing about yoga class I like – is that when you practice yoga, you are so involved in it, you don’t notice anything else. And for me it primarily comes through steady breathing.
I couldn’t follow this DVD breath-wise – at some moments you are ready to exhale, and hear: “inhale”. this completely turned me off. Couldn’t wait for it to finish.
But as a prenatal exercise i’d still recomment this DVD, especially short forms. It really puts a focus on hips, and even though i’m a practitioner with 1 year experience, after this workout I felt my quads a little sore the next day. Also, very good as a hip opener – I could advance in my regular practice as well.
My advice is go for it, but do not expect it to be more than a good prenatal workout.
